求多线程的全面解释和用途
来源:
2022-07-14 17:00:14
导读 【求多线程的全面解释和用途】多线程是一种让程序同时执行多个任务的技术,提升系统效率与响应速度。通过将任务分解为多个线程,操作系统可
【求多线程的全面解释和用途】多线程是一种让程序同时执行多个任务的技术,提升系统效率与响应速度。通过将任务分解为多个线程,操作系统可并行处理,提高资源利用率。
| 项目 | 内容 |
| 定义 | 多线程指在同一个进程中同时运行多个线程,共享内存空间,提高执行效率。 |
| 优点 | 提高程序响应速度、充分利用CPU资源、简化复杂任务处理。 |
| 缺点 | 线程间同步复杂、可能引发死锁、调试难度大。 |
| 应用场景 | 网络服务器、图形界面应用、科学计算、实时数据处理等。 |
多线程广泛应用于现代软件开发中,合理使用能显著提升性能,但需注意线程安全与资源管理。
以上就是【求多线程的全面解释和用途】相关内容,希望对您有所帮助。
免责声明:本文由用户上传,如有侵权请联系删除!